## Fire-Drill Roll Call — Assistants

Drills at Kelsworth House run quarterly, first Tuesday, 10:30. Assistants collect the printed team roster from the copy room beforehand. Muster point: east car park, flag B. Tick names against badge scans; report absentees to the warden within five minutes. Do not re-enter until the all-clear. To retrieve the roster cabinet key after hours, use the code below.

door code, yagap-bahof: bdg-O-05

# Pingleaf Reminder Job — Environments

Quick orientation for support folks: the clinic appointment reminder job runs in three environments — sandbox, pilot, and live. Sandbox never sends real messages, pilot sends only to the Oakhollow test clinic, and live is the real deal. If a patient says they got a reminder twice, check which environment the clinic is mapped to first. Here's what live is currently running with.

service settings:
PRAWYN_PIN=9848
PRAWYN_METRICS_HOST=metrics.prawyn.lumicworks.corp
PRAWYN_LOG_LEVEL=warn
PRAWYN_TENANT=pelius

# Basement Archive Room — Night Access

The archive room under Pellworth House holds old contracts and the tape backups. Night shift: take stairwell C, not the lift (it's switched off after midnight). Lights are on a timer by the door — slap the button as you go in. Sign the logbook, even at 3am, yes really. The keypad by the door takes the code below.

staff pass of fahap-tajeg = bdg-FT-6

Ticket: Configuration drift detected in TerraNote's offline mode between staging and the release candidate. Staging syncs survey plots every 15 minutes with conflict resolution set to last-write-wins, while the RC build shipped with merge-based resolution and a 60-minute sync window. Field crews in the Dalbren pilot reported duplicate plot records, which matches this mismatch. Before we cut the next release, please verify against the canonical values below. The expected configuration for the release build is as follows.

deployment values, yahag-tawef:
ZORWYN_HOST=zorwyn.tolvaqlabs.internal
ZORWYN_PORT=9300